你查询的IP:[119.128.239.197]  地理位置:中国–广东–东莞

最新查询121.255.165.247 121.60.233.209 221.136.138.200 58.128.156.51 60.194.149.206 121.16.77.247 221.200.44.239 122.51.234.114 60.55.126.167 119.128.239.197 162.105.133.251 202.90.252.71 202.38.150.115 210.14.128.250 123.244.24.240 119.19.126.52 218.15.4.38 116.58.128.185 118.228.5.23 117.72.37.17 202.158.160.111 202.38.168.205 219.224.67.73 203.94.239.91 122.200.64.168 59.80.175.85 119.88.9.147 202.149.224.196 124.64.72.192 124.20.18.125 202.122.27.136